Despite showing up without a reservation (with two young children reservations are difficult), we were given a proper tour and tasting. The tour was one-on-one and very informative. The property is exceptional, though due to attention to signage as it can be somewhat tricky to locate. After the tour we were offered tastings of a number of Brunello vintages, Rosso, Grappa and the exceptional olive oil pressed on the premises. We enjoyed the wine so much we had a case shipped home. I would like to note that the Brunello prices were on the lower end of what we found in Montalcino, similarly the shipping rate was the lowest we were offered during our two week stay in the region.
